Basic Concepts of Shaft Collars
Shaft collars are mechanical components used to secure, position, and align parts on a shaft. They are commonly employed in various mechanical systems to ensure that components remain in the correct location and orientation. There are several types of shaft collars, including plain collars, clamp style collars, and cam lock collars, each suited to different applications based on the specific needs of the system. These components are integral to maintaining the integrity and functionality of mechanical assemblies 1.

Cummins: A Brief Overview
Cummins Inc. is a global power leader that designs, manufactures, and distributes a wide range of power solutions, including engines, filtration, emissions solutions, and related technologies. With a history of innovation and commitment to quality, Cummins serves customers in approximately 190 countries and territories through a network of more than 600 company-owned and independent distributor locations and approximately 7,400 dealer locations. The company’s product range includes engines and components for on-highway, off-highway, and stationary applications, demonstrating its versatility and expertise in the automotive and heavy-duty truck industry.

Interaction with the Damper
The damper is a component designed to absorb and dampen vibrations within the engine system. When the 4982223 is installed, it holds the damper in place, ensuring that it remains correctly aligned with the shaft. This alignment is vital for the damper to effectively perform its function. Without the shaft collar, the damper could shift or move, leading to inefficient vibration absorption and potential damage to other components.
